2. SCOPE
Support includes, but is not limited to
Customizing xMatter Alert Management system for alerting/notification.
Performing system administration of windows 2003 Servers.
Maintaining xMatter Alert Management System and HP network automation MS SQL databases.
Working with other network management systems (NMS) tools administrators to integrate xMatter Alert Management System with other NMS.
Perform Scripting, automation file maintenances, regular expression rule updates, and TCL Scripting code updates for custom IRS written rules.
Ensure Servers and Databases are backed up.

6. CLEARENCE REQUIRED PRIOR TO START
Candidates with a current valid IRS issued Minimum Background Investigation (MBI) interim or final clearance, or a currently active Top Secret (TS) clearance issued within the past two years are highly preferred. Consideration will be given to exceptionally qualified candidates who do not hold one of these two clearances, if their ability to obtain a Public Trust level clearance can be demonstrated through prior issuance of a Public Trust or higher level clearance by a Federal Agency. Proof of current or prior clearance must be submitted with the applicants Resume.
